EDMONTON – A 21-year-old Indian student or immigrant from India has been charged with assaulting five children at an Edmonton daycare where she worked.

Navam Sharma, an employee of the Sherwood Park daycare, has been charged with five counts of assault.

She has been released on conditions and is scheduled to appear in court on July 9.

Police say none of the children were seriously injured.

Mounties received a complaint of one assault at Emerald Park Daycare on Pembina Road on April 3.

An investigation led to the discovery of the other victims.

Strathcona County RCMP received a complaint of an assault which is alleged to have occurred at Emerald Park Daycare in Sherwood Park, Alta. Strathcona County General Investigative Section (GIS) was called in to investigate, and to date, five victims between the ages of 5 and 8 years old have been identified. 

The assaults occurred between March 17, 2025 and April 3, 2025. No serious injuries reported or medical attention required as a result of the incidents.
